Kohima | September 15

A four-day long Fathers' Brigade for Men's Department of the Angami Baptist Church Council (ABCC) got underway at Baptist College, Sechü Campus from September 15.

The opening ceremony took place this afternoon with a prayer by ABCC president Rev. Megovotuo Kuotsu and act of salute by Rev Mekhale Yhoshü, President, ABCCTK. Penalty shoot –out marked the opening ceremony.

Over 800 participants, including 600 campers, 130 officials and 70 catering volunteers from 110 churches under ABCC are attending the Fathers' Brigade under the theme, “Be strong in the Lord and in his mighty power.”

It will continue till September 18.

During the four-day brigade, the campers have been divided into four groups, and will compete in events like march past, Naga wrestling, tug of war, volleyball, shooting, penalty shoot-out, debate, extempore, singing competition and indigenous games.

The speakers for the brigade will include, Rev Dr V Atsi Dolie, Rev Dr Rachülie Vihienuo, Rev Vicavor Krose, Dr Kethoser Kevichüsa, Dr Hovithal Sothu and Lhouliehunuo Sale.
